We know, … WebSolution: The momentum of a photon of wavelength λ is calculated using the formula, P = h/λ. So, the momentum of a photon having a wavelength of 500 nm is: = [6.63×10 -34 ]/ [500×10 -9 ] =>P = 1.32 x 10 -27 kg m s -1.
